the default_subtargets template was a bad idea, since different makefiles require different types of dependencies for subtargets. nuke it...

SVN-Revision: 7003
This commit is contained in:
Felix Fietkau
2007-04-18 17:35:46 +00:00
parent 532654e3c6
commit 1099e2d679
4 changed files with 23 additions and 25 deletions

View File

@@ -131,27 +131,6 @@ $(call shvar,$(1))=$$(call $(1))
export $(call shvar,$(1))
endef
# Default targets for subdirectory calls
# Parameters:
# 1: dependencies for the prepare step
define default_subtargets
%-download: FORCE
$$(MAKE) -C $$(patsubst %-download,%,$$@) download
%-prepare: $(1) FORCE
$$(MAKE) -C $$(patsubst %-prepare,%,$$@) prepare
%-compile: %-prepare
$$(MAKE) -C $$(patsubst %-compile,%,$$@) compile
%-install:
$$(MAKE) -C $$(patsubst %-install,%,$$@) install
%-clean: FORCE
@$$(MAKE) -C $$(patsubst %-clean,%,$$@) clean
endef
all:
FORCE: ;
.PHONY: FORCE